Error description
If an MQ import receives an inbound response but cannot retrieve the associated callback message then the import fails to create an MQ Failed Event in the FEM as it expects to have a callback message. The case where the callback message is missing should be handled.

Problem conclusion
The product code was modified to correct this issue. There are no known side effects as-sociated with this code change. The fix was targeted to be included in the following fix packs: v7.0.0 Fix Pack 3 (7.0.0.3)
